本文来自网络
当你从代码库里面更新自己本地的工作拷贝的时候,update返回的值意思如下: u foo 文件foo更新了(从服务器收到修改). A foo 文件或目录foo被添加到工作拷贝。 D foo 文件或目录foo在工作拷贝被删除了。 R foo 文件或目录foo在工作拷贝已经被替换了,这是说,foo被删除,而一个新的同样的名字的项目添加进来,他们具有同样的名字,但是版本 库会把他们看作具备不同历史的不同对像。 G foo 文件foo 接收版本库德更改,你的本地版本也已经修改,但改变没有相互影响,Subversion成功的将版本库和本地文件合并,没有发生任何问题。 C foo 文件foo 的修改与服务器冲突,服务器的修改与你的修改交叠在一起,这种冲突需要人为来解决。 |